Transaction 58fb6bad2317ca83ce9d61cff17223e3ea54d1efb76d40fbe1196b91e8e2d284
1 Input
1 Output
-
58fb6bad2317ca83ce9d61cff17223e3ea54d1efb76d40fbe1196b91e8e2d284:0
- value
- 93309
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dd2954889e42210eec986d057914810b833cf9d
- address
- bc1qhhff2jyfus3ppmkfsmg90y2gzzur8nuad9xua4